WebGrief, regret, anger, uncertainty, sadness and/or a feeling of emptiness may accompany the loss. But remember to allow yourself time to grieve. A new cat will not replace your deceased pet in your affections or your heart, but can eventually help ease the pain of the loss. Adopting a needy pet can also be a loving tribute to your beloved cat.

You and your cat will spend their final moments in the place you shared your best … sesh screen saverWebThe euthanasia medication most vets use is pentobarbital, a seizure medication. In large doses, it quickly renders the pet unconscious. It shuts down their heart and brain functions usually within one or two minutes. It is usually given by an IV injection in one of their legs.
